加入收藏 | 设为首页 | 会员中心 | 我要投稿 92站长网 (https://www.92zhanzhang.com/)- 视觉智能、智能语音交互、边缘计算、物联网、开发!
当前位置: 首页 > 综合聚焦 > 编程要点 > 资讯 > 正文

资讯编译×代码优化:前端艺术师的实战指南

发布时间:2026-06-24 11:47:32 所属栏目:资讯 来源:DaWei
导读:  在现代前端开发中,资讯编译与代码优化早已超越技术范畴,成为一种艺术表达。每一位前端艺术师不仅需要理解用户界面的视觉逻辑,更要掌握如何以高效、优雅的方式实现这些构想。资讯编译,是将纷繁复杂的网络信息

  在现代前端开发中,资讯编译与代码优化早已超越技术范畴,成为一种艺术表达。每一位前端艺术师不仅需要理解用户界面的视觉逻辑,更要掌握如何以高效、优雅的方式实现这些构想。资讯编译,是将纷繁复杂的网络信息、设计规范与业务需求,转化为可执行的代码蓝图;而代码优化,则是在不牺牲功能的前提下,让页面更快、更轻、更稳定。


AI渲染图,仅供参考

  资讯编译的核心在于“提炼”。面对海量文档、框架更新和第三方库说明,开发者必须具备快速识别关键信息的能力。例如,在引入一个新的状态管理方案时,不应盲目照搬示例代码,而应分析其适用场景、性能瓶颈与生态支持。通过建立个人知识库,将常用技术点结构化整理,能显著提升信息转化效率。一个高效的编译流程,往往始于清晰的问题定义:我要解决什么?目标用户是谁?性能阈值是多少?


  代码优化则是一场关于“克制”的修行。冗余的组件嵌套、未按需加载的资源、过度复杂的条件判断,都会拖慢页面响应速度。使用工具如Webpack Bundle Analyzer可以直观查看打包体积分布,从而定位“大块头”模块。通过动态导入(dynamic import)实现懒加载,配合React的Suspense或Vue的异步组件,能让首屏加载时间大幅缩短。同时,合理使用CSS-in-JS或原子类框架(如Tailwind CSS),能减少重复样式,提升维护性。


  在实际项目中,性能优化并非一蹴而就。一次表单提交的延迟,可能源于未优化的事件监听器;一个动画卡顿,或许只是因为频繁触发了重排(reflow)。通过浏览器开发者工具中的Performance面板,可以精准捕捉每一帧的耗时,进而定位问题。比如,避免在循环中进行DOM操作,改用文档片段(DocumentFragment)批量插入,或将样式变更集中处理,都能有效降低渲染压力。


  代码的可读性与可维护性同样是艺术的一部分。变量命名应体现语义,函数职责单一,注释恰到好处。当团队协作时,统一的编码规范(如ESLint + Prettier)能减少沟通成本。一段看似“聪明”的压缩代码,若难以理解,反而会成为后期维护的陷阱。真正的优化,是让代码既高效又易懂。


  前端艺术师的价值,不仅在于实现功能,更在于创造流畅的用户体验。每一次优化,都是对性能、可读性与可扩展性的平衡尝试。当资讯被精准编译,代码被精心雕琢,最终交付的不仅是页面,更是一种无声的承诺——对速度的尊重,对细节的执着,以及对用户感受的深切关怀。

(编辑:92站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章